Crochet Woody The Beaver Pattern

Crochet Woody The Beaver Pattern

Uses: The finished piece should measure about H. 5.5” x L. 3” x W. 5”! A striking decor piece, Woody fits perfectly into any space, introducing a warm atmosphere and conversation starter.
Materials:
DK yarn
3.25mm crochet hook
Making:
The head starts off with six single crochet in a magic ring and gradually adds more stitches in subsequent rounds. After round 16, dec stitches are added before stuffing and closing the head. Similarly, the ears and cheeks crocheted separately as flat pieces and then attached to the head. The body started with a magic ring, with increases per round up to round 7, then continued with multiple single crochets up to round 19. The crocheting decreases from round 20 before sewing and stuffing. Finally, the tail created with multiple rounds of single crochet, some increase rounds, and then progressive decrease rounds towards the end of the body before it is sewn onto the body.

Crochet Mini Beaver Amigurumi Pattern

Crochet Mini Beaver Amigurumi Pattern

Uses: This soft, cuddly little creation brings woodland wonder into your arms, providing a touch of nature's magic to homes and hearts.
Materials:
Sport yarn
2.5mm crochet hook
Making:
The head and body of the beaver are crocheted as one piece using Chestnut-colored yarn. By working in spiral rounds, one starts with a magic ring and proceeds through a pattern of single crochets, with increases and decreases strategically placed to shape the form. The body starts with a base of simple stitches and grows into a rounded 3D form, with safety eyes applied after several rounds, before narrowing again to form the neck and body. The tail is a distinctive part of the beaver and is also crocheted in spiral rounds using the Coffee color. It starts with a magic ring and expands through rounds of single crochet stitches, and increases before a series of flat rounds creates the beaver’s classic wide, textured tail, with decreases at the end to taper it off. Once all parts are crocheted, they sewn together according to the assembly instructions.

Crochet Amigurumi Beaver Boris Pattern

Crochet Amigurumi Beaver Boris Pattern

Uses: It can serve as a gorgeous keychain add-on for your handbag or a charismatic ornament to hang from your car mirror. Promising hours of blissful crocheting, its compact size (10 cm tall) makes it a friend that's easy to carry around.
Materials:
Sport yarn
2.5mm crochet hook
Making:
The crochet pattern begins with the creation of Boris' head and body, which is shaped using a crochet hook and a series of rounds (Rnd) worked in single crochets (sc) and increases (inc) or decreases (dec). Next, the muzzle is formed with a separate piece, involving rounds of single crochets and increases. Once completed, it is stuffed and sewn onto the head and detailed with an embroidered nose, mouth, and teeth. Two versions of eyes are available – flat crochet eyes and 3D safety eyes. Whichever version you choose, make a pair of eyes and attach them to Boris' head. The tail was created using a series of rounds similar to other body parts but with additional embroidery work for added detail. After completing the crochet process, sew the tail onto Boris' body.
